Freshly set up in-house by our esteemed Guitar Tech, this Stromberg Voisinet parlor guitar is ready to make some beautiful music with you.  Recently repaired and serviced by one of the Northwest's finest luthiery shops, Portland Fretworks, where the guitar received a neck rest and bridge re-glue.  In Good vintage condition with noticeable play wear, but nothing egregious.  This is a sweet instrument from an age when parlor guitars were found in every "cultured" household.  A nice piece of history to add to your collection.

SPECS:

Nickel 3/Plate Tuners on Slotted Headstock

Original 1 11/16" Bone Nut

V-Shape Mahogany Neck with 24 3/8" Scale Length

Neck Depth .88" at First Fret and 1.06" at Tenth Fret

18 Very Small Frets in Good Vintage Condition

Dyed Pearwood Fingerboard with Flat Radius

Missing 7th Fret Inlay

Dyed Maple Bridge with Newer Bone Saddle

All Mahogany in Natural Finish with Laurel Decal

Weight 2 lb 15 oz

Later Chipboard Case

No Serial Number
